diff --git a/fs/proc_namespace.c b/fs/proc_namespace.c index f3878785aff1..3059a9394c2d 100644 --- a/fs/proc_namespace.c +++ b/fs/proc_namespace.c @@ -121,9 +121,7 @@ static int show_vfsmnt(struct seq_file *m, struct vfsmount *mnt) if (err) goto out; show_mnt_opts(m, mnt); - if (sb->s_op->show_options2) - err = sb->s_op->show_options2(mnt, m, mnt_path.dentry); - else if (sb->s_op->show_options) + if (sb->s_op->show_options) err = sb->s_op->show_options(m, mnt_path.dentry); seq_puts(m, " 0 0\n"); out: @@ -185,9 +183,7 @@ static int show_mountinfo(struct seq_file *m, struct vfsmount *mnt) err = show_sb_opts(m, sb); if (err) goto out; - if (sb->s_op->show_options2) { - err = sb->s_op->show_options2(mnt, m, mnt->mnt_root); - } else if (sb->s_op->show_options) + if (sb->s_op->show_options) err = sb->s_op->show_options(m, mnt->mnt_root); seq_putc(m, '\n'); out: diff --git a/include/linux/fs.h b/include/linux/fs.h index 5f2162211ec4..5dfd7efadb28 100644 --- a/include/linux/fs.h +++ b/include/linux/fs.h @@ -1937,7 +1937,6 @@ struct super_operations { void (*umount_begin) (struct super_block *); int (*show_options)(struct seq_file *, struct dentry *); - int (*show_options2)(struct vfsmount *,struct seq_file *, struct dentry *); int (*show_devname)(struct seq_file *, struct dentry *); int (*show_path)(struct seq_file *, struct dentry *); int (*show_stats)(struct seq_file *, struct dentry *);